My Brother found a thread on the "Generic PUPx" program on the McAfee site that says to run Super Spyware and Malwarebytes program while the system back up is off fixes it. When I tried to down load Malwarebytes I receive the same pop up from McAfee that it removed a Trojan virus as I do when it started up yesterday and today. Superspyware down loaded fine and when it restarted (after finding and fix'n 115 files) I didn't get the buffer over flow or generic PUP program warnings from McAfee just the Generic Trojan virus (2 or more of them).
I had a part on order and sent an e-mail request to check on it as I had no info and had placed the order over two weeks ago. A message showed up in my spam folder, who it said was from UPS Mail. It had a file attached and advised me to print off the attached receipt and contact my local UPS to get order. I did and I could not open the file when I down loaded it. I called around and nothing could be found on the tracking number listed on the subject line of the e-mail. Thats when the rs32net file showed up in my regestry.
